FACT, Liverpool
The Foundation for Art & Creative Technology (FACT) is Britain’s principal electronic arts organisation and Liverpool’s first purpose-built arts centre for more than 60 years. It celebrates an ever-expanding visual culture that embraces moving and still pictures, digital imaging, film and interactive creative technologies.
Built on a tight city centre site in the Ropewalks redevelopment area, the Austin-Smith:Lord building contains three state of the art cinema screens, two gallery spaces, a flexible events space, creative design laboratories, a media lounge and a bar and café. All have exemplary standards of access for disabled users. The project creates a centre for moving image art and culture unrivalled in its scope, scale and ambition in the UK.
LOCATION: LIVERPOOL
CLIENT: THE FOUNDATION FOR ART & CREATIVE TECHNOLOGY (FACT)
VALUE: £8.1M
COMPLETION: 2004
SERVICE: ARCHITECTURE, LANDSCAPE
SECTOR: ARTS & CULTURE
CONTRACTOR: JOHN MOWLEM & CO PLC
LANDSCAPE: AUSTIN-SMITH:LORD
STRUCTURES: BURO HAPPOLD
SERVICES: BURO HAPPOLD
COST CONSULTANT: REX PROCTOR & PARTNERS
